Position Purpose:

Recovery Specialists must be eligible to pursue Certified Recovery Support Specialist credential (CRSS) based on their lived experience. Provide recovery-oriented, person centered, and trauma informed services; serve as an advocate; provide information and support for individuals in emergency, outpatient and walk-in settings. Participate as a team member in the delivery of treatment services to clients and their families and to facilitate the issues of recovery into their daily living situations. Provide continuity of program services in an ethical, legal and moral manner within a safe and therapeutic environment, consistent with applicable regulatory and accreditation standards.

Schedule: 8-hour shifts (2nd shift)

  • Days: Tuesday - Saturday
  • Hours: 4:00pm - 12:30am

Qualifications/Basic Job Requirements:

  • High school diploma, GED or higher education
  • Advocate for individuals using professionalism and non-adversarial approach
  • Willingness, ability and commitment to serve as a role model for recovery
  • Valid Illinois driver’s license
  • Minimum (RSA)

Essential Responsibilities:

  • Provide appropriate behavioral interventions and advocacy for individuals with mental health disorders.
  • Have a thorough understanding of community resources and Rosecrance full array of services.
  • Attend trainings toward CRSS credential
  • Participate in statewide events/summits/trainings/activities that support the education and development of consumer provider services.
  • Attend all scheduled meetings of staff, team meetings or appropriate committee meetings as designated.
  • Serve as a member of the assigned team and participate in all team meetings and activities.
  • Exercise confidentiality in keeping with the professional code of conduct and within the framework of the law.
  • Facilitate transportation of clients to Rosecrance buildings or hospitals as needed.
  • Deliver exceptional customer service consistently to every customer.
  • Serve as a role model and demonstrate positive guest relations in representing the agency.

Job Type: Full-time

Pay: Based on education, experience, and credentials

  • Starting pay - $18/hr

Shift differentials: Additional pay based on regularly scheduled shift hours

  • Second shift (majority of hours between 3pm and 11pm): $.25/hr
  • Third shift (majority of hours between 11pm and 7am): $.50/hr

Work Location: Rosecrance Mulberry Center – Rockford, IL
